MINUTES OF THE <br /> ORONO PLANNING COMMISSION MEETING <br /> Tuesday,February 21,2012 <br /> 6:30 o'clock p.m. <br /> Staff recommends establishment of an escrow or escrows to guarantee the completion of the proposed <br /> improvement plans(wetland,tree and prairie)in an amount to be determined by the City Engineer. <br /> The Planning Commission should consider the submitted conservation design analysis and improvement <br /> plan. If the Commission agrees with the findings of the report,which seem to indicate few existing, <br /> pristine,quality natural features exist on site,yet offers opportunities and plans for enhancement and <br /> protection, a motion to approve the subdivision should be considered. <br /> Thiesse asked whether septic sites are allowed in the Conservation Design area. , <br /> Curtis indicated septic sites are allowed. <br /> Gherardi stated she does not plan on developing the second five acre lot initially and that it will remain <br /> vacant for the time being. <br /> Schoenzeit asked if the applicant is amenable to the covenants and escrows recommended by Staff. <br /> Gherardi indicated she is. <br /> Wayne Jacobson,Jacobson Environmental,stated his experience with wetlands goes back to 1993. <br /> Jacobson stated the north quarter section of the lot is good as is, but one of the things that he would <br /> encourage from a property owner standpoint is,when the lot is split,to perhaps be a little flexible with the <br /> width of the buffer. This type of situation could call for a 200 to 300 foot wildlife buffer. The property <br /> owners in the future may have a different plan and it would be nice to have a little flexibility with the <br /> south grassland area. Jacobson commented the Conservation Design Ordinance is a good idea. <br /> Chair Schoenzeit opened the public hearing at 6:38 p.m. <br /> There were no public comments regarding this application. <br /> Chair Schoenzeit closed the public hearing at 6:38 p.m. <br /> Thiesse asked if this area is a delineated grassland. <br /> Curtis stated the area indicated on the overhead and in the Conservation Design Plan is the area that Staff <br /> would recommend be protected by easements. If there is some deviation from that in the future,the <br /> conservation easement would need to be amended. <br /> Landgraver moved,Schwingler seconded,to recommend approval of Application#11-3531,Lori <br /> Gherardi on behalf of Wolverton Place,LLC,4550 Wolverton Place,granting of subdivision <br /> approval,subject to Staff s recommendations. VOTE: Ayes 6,Nays 0. <br /> 3. #12-3538 ROBERTS RESIDENTIAL REMODELING ON BEHALF OF COLIN AND <br /> ANNA PETERS,3520 NORTH SHORE DRIVE,6:41 P.M.-6: 53 P.M. <br /> John Paggen,Roberts Residential Remodeling,was present on behalf of the Applicants. <br /> Page 2 <br />
